编程问题解析:问题描述: 编写一个程序,接收两个整数参数,计算它们的平均值,并输出结果。 输入输出示例:…


编程问题解析:如何计算两个整数的平均值

背景介绍

在编程学习中,我们经常遇到需要进行数学运算的问题。本问题要求通过两个整数参数计算它们的平均值,并输出结果。平均值的计算公式为:(a + b) / 2,其中a和b是输入的整数参数。

思路分析

计算两个整数的平均值需要明确以下几点:
1. 数据类型处理:由于输入是整数,直接相加除以2会自动转换为浮点数,无需额外处理。
2. 除法运算:在Python中,除法运算符/会自动处理除法,无需手动计算。
3. 输入验证:虽然题目明确要求输入是整数,但无需额外验证,因为题目中已经保证输入正确。

代码实现

def average(a, b):
    """计算两个整数的平均值"""
    return (a + b) / 2

# 示例使用
average(3, 6)

总结

该程序通过定义一个函数实现简单的数学计算,展示了编程思维的核心:清晰地将问题分解为可执行的代码块。函数的设计使代码易于阅读和维护,同时保持了简洁的结构。通过调用该函数,我们能够轻松地得到两个整数的平均值,无论输入的数是什么,都不会影响结果的正确性。该实现也验证了Python中除法运算符/的自动处理特性。